What are hifi reviews useful for? (1) Identifying products you should demo in person at a dealer. (2) Learning which products reviewers unanimously praise as the best they've heard (this means they probably are legitimately great). (3) Identifying a product's attributes that satisfy your idiosyncratic needs and tastes. Beyond that, we often discount what reviewers say because they heap praise on most products—and are often apprehensive about publishing strong criticism or comparisons between products. Further, they seldom have more than a few products on-hand, often relying on their memories to compare past products. Always listen for yourself.

Manufacturer details

  • Dimensions (WxHxD): 26 x 103 x 34 cm (10.2" x 40.6" x 13.8")
  • Weight: 24.8 kg
  • Acoustic Principle: 3-way bass reflex
  • Tweeter: 25mm Ceramic
  • Midrange Driver: 174mm Titanium-graphite
  • Woofer: 2x 174mm Titanium-graphite
  • Nominal Load Capacity: 140 watts
  • Music Load Capacity: 250 watts
  • Transmission Range: 20-40,000 Hz
  • Crossover Frequencies: 170/3,000 Hz
  • Impedance: 4-8 ohm
The Vento 80 is a slim 3-way bass reflex floorstanding speaker with harmonious proportions and an elegant, refined appearance. Its technical features and superior sound development will delight audiophile music fans and fans of high dynamics alike. The Vento 80 convince with the incomparably good Canton sound, highest durability and finest workmanship.

Taking a step back to look at reviewers' thoughts of the brand's entire lineup—not just this product—what stands out most is the following:

  • Canton's Reference line combines years of experience with advanced computer modeling and a dedicated testing laboratory, resulting in products designed with both precision and innovation.
  • The brand emphasizes high-quality construction, utilizing stiff, multi-layer laminate cabinets with strategic internal bracing to minimize unwanted resonances.
  • Canton's signature sound aims for a neutral and balanced presentation, delivering clear, detailed sound without excessive coloration.
  • They often incorporate advanced driver technologies, such as ceramic-tungsten cones and aluminum-ceramic-oxide tweeters, to achieve optimal stiffness, damping, and dispersion.

The Reference 7 K - our second smallest floorstanding speaker from the Reference K series and yet an absolutely grown-up speaker that makes no compromises in sound and boasts the best virtues from Canton. The Reference 7 K grows exactly 100 centimeters in height. It lends itself to any living space thanks to its harmonious proportions and noble surface design. 

The two ceramic tungsten bass drivers with a diameter of 174 millimeters, specially developed for the Reference K series, ensure a powerful performance and breathtaking bass. Exactly the same size is the midrange specialist, which with its light and stiff ceramic tungsten cone reproduces mid-range sounds in an inimitable manner highly neutral and balanced. 

Thanks to the low-loss wave surrounds that sandwich the midrange and woofer, and the superbly resolving ceramic tweeter, the Reference 7 Ks impress with their excellent fine dynamics even at low volumes. The acoustically optimized enclosures with curved side walls and rounded edges ensure ideal dispersion characteristics of the slim floorstanding speakers.

Product Strengths

  • The enclosure is formed from several layers of wood glued together to achieve a stiff, well-damped structure
  • Premium-quality components in its crossover
  • Clear, refined treble and midrange and focused bass with ample weight
  • Wide soundstage
  • Music plays as a thoroughly human event, touchable textures and silky physicality joined to satisfying, juicy tonality

Product Considerations

  • One reviewer destroyed the tweeter of a Reference 7K sample by neglecting to reduce the volume control of the digital audio interface
  • High-gloss finishes might require regular dusting
  • Finding the optimal positions in the room might be difficult

Comparisons (according to reviewers)

  • Compared to Triangle, the Canton Reference 7K has a more neutral high end, though Triangle has high sensitivity, meaning it would be a better match for low-powered amplifiers
  • Compared to Bowers & Wilkins and Focal, the Canton Reference 7K can be viewed as quite the value and equally or even more premium looking

Takeaway: The Canton Reference 7K is a well-engineered speaker employing high-tech materials that plays all styles of music well and casts a giant soundstage. It is a reasonably dynamic speaker producing a satisfyingly thick—detailed sound.

Product Strengths

  • A complete and satisfying sound from top to bottom
  • Well-built speaker cabinet with a stiff, low-resonance enclosure due to curved sides and laminated layers of fiberboard
  • A cool, dry and neutral tonal balance
  • Midrange shines with excellent voice rendition and believable subtle textures of instruments
  • Exceptionally wide dynamic range due to very low cabinet coloration

Product Considerations

  • Bass lacks output in the lowest (20-40Hz) octave
  • High frequencies weren't quite as extended as some other speakers
  • Depth perception of the imaging seems a little constrained
  • The simple stud-like spikes supplied are clearly intended to avoid damaging wooden floors, and are probably insufficiently sharp to pierce carpets
  • Mid-bass output is a little strong

Takeaway: The Canton Reference 5 DC gives a complete musical experience and its quality ensures enjoyment of the music. For speakers that sound good, the Reference 5 DC speakers are a possible choice.

KLH Audio pioneered the first-ever high-selectivity FM table radio and the first full-range electrostatic loudspeaker, with their Model Nine being recognized as one of the twelve best loudspeakers ever built. The brand is known for its acoustic suspension design that uses the air volume inside the housing as an air spring, which significantly reduces distortion compared to conventional bass reflex structures, and includes an Acoustic Balance Control that lets users adjust the speaker's output to their room acoustics.

Product Strengths

  • Retro aesthetics reminiscent of vintage speakers, with a well-applied veneer and woven front panel
  • Balanced sound with clarity in the midrange and treble, creating an immersive listening experience
  • Good sensitivity makes them relatively easy to drive with a range of amplifiers
  • Acoustic suspension design provides tight bass and allows for flexible placement near walls
  • Three-position attenuation switch allows for adjustment to different room acoustics

Product Considerations

  • Can sound a bit bright out of the box, requiring a break-in period
  • Sound can harden a little when provoked by poor or bright recordings, and they are finicky about upstream electronics
  • Bass might not be punchy enough for some listeners, potentially requiring a subwoofer or EQ adjustments
  • Lack of provision for spikes to fasten the speakers to the carpet
  • Grilles need to be off for best sound, according to one reviewer

Comparisons (according to reviewers)

  • Compared to the JBL L100, the Model Five is better balanced and more enjoyable to listen to
  • Compared to the NHT C3, the Model Five is an upgraded variant, offering deeper, wider sound and more resolution
  • Compared to the Buchardt S400, the Model Five sounds more open, brighter, and more detailed—with better instrument placement
  • Compared to the Aurender S5W, the Model Five reaches lower frequencies and has better overall resolution and detail
  • Compared to the Graham LS6, they perform on par, albeit via a different approach, trading in some refinement for a more direct—in-your-face sound

Takeaway: The KLH Model Five is a speaker with retro style and balanced sound. They are versatile and can be used in different listening spaces.
